2016年10月17日

C# 调用外部dll(转)

摘要: C# 调用外部dll 一、 DLL与应用程序 动态链接库(也称为DLL,即为“Dynamic Link Library”的缩写)是Microsoft Windows最重要的组成要素之一,打开Windows系统文件夹,你会发现文件夹中有很多DLL文件,Windows就是将一些主要的系统功能以DLL模块 阅读全文

posted @ 2016-10-17 16:56 _ali 阅读(89303) 评论(2) 推荐(7) 编辑

2016年10月15日

基于RBAC的权限设计模型

摘要: 基于RBAC的权限设计模型权限分析文档基于RBAC的权限设计模型:1RBAC介绍RBAC模型作为目前最为广泛接受的权限模型。NIST(TheNationalInstituteofStandardsandTechnology,美国国家标准与技术研究院)标准RBAC模型由4个部件模型组成,这4个部件模型分别是基本模型RBAC0(CoreRBAC)、角色分级... 阅读全文

posted @ 2016-10-15 10:07 _ali 阅读(23198) 评论(0) 推荐(0) 编辑

RBAC用户权限管理数据库设计

摘要: http://minjiechenjava.iteye.com/blog/1759482 RBAC用户权限管理数据库设计 博客分类: RBAC 权限设计 RBAC RBAC(Role-Based Access Control,基于角色的访问控制),就是用户通过角色与权限进行关联。简单地说,一个用户拥有若干角色,每一个角色拥有若干权限。这样,就构造成"用户-角色-权限"的授权... 阅读全文

posted @ 2016-10-15 10:03 _ali 阅读(2621) 评论(1) 推荐(0) 编辑

2016年10月14日

系统多语言实践(二)

摘要: 转:http://blog.csdn.net/cassaba/article/details/21382193 1. 多语言存储 假设下面一个场景: 系统有一个产品目录需要维护,目录名称和描述需要支持多语言存储。表结构设计如下: PRODUCT_CATEGORY PK栏位类型允许NULL描述PKIDVARCHAR(36)N类别Id LANG_IDVARCHAR(3... 阅读全文

posted @ 2016-10-14 13:43 _ali 阅读(336) 评论(0) 推荐(0) 编辑

多语言系统的数据库设计

摘要: 首先我们需要确认我们要做的系统,多语言到底是要做多少种语言,以后会不会要求增加更多的语言。比如我们做一个给中国大陆和纽伦新港使用的系统,可以确定的语言就是简体中文、繁体中文和英语,而且可以确定以后也不会增加语言。确定以后是否需要增加语言这一点很重要,决定了我们在数据库设计时,是否需要考虑多语上的扩展 阅读全文

posted @ 2016-10-14 13:43 _ali 阅读(5936) 评论(0) 推荐(1) 编辑

系统多语言实践(一)

摘要: 原文地址:http://blog.csdn.net/cassaba/article/details/21236679 应用系统支持多语言,在有跨国业务的公司中,是个很常见的需求。一般涉及到的语言有中简、中繁、英文、日语等。本文就.Net Web平台下实现该需求做一些初步探讨。在Asp.Net Web Form时代,微软就给出了一个解决方案。简单来讲,就是将多语言资料维护到*.{Culture Co... 阅读全文

posted @ 2016-10-14 11:12 _ali 阅读(1042) 评论(0) 推荐(0) 编辑

2016年10月13日

C#键盘事件处理(来源网上)

摘要: C#键盘事件处理 如果你希望用户按F1弹出chm帮助,代码如下: 键盘事件是在用户按下键盘上的一个键的时候发生的,可分为两类。第一类是KeyPress事件,当按下的键表示的是一个ASCII字符的时候就会触发这类事件,可通过他的KeyPressEventArgs类型参数的属性KeyChar来确定按下的 阅读全文

posted @ 2016-10-13 10:39 _ali 阅读(13058) 评论(0) 推荐(1) 编辑

2016年9月30日

DataTable.DataRow的复制

摘要: 经常遇到这种错误,“此行已属于另一个表”的错误,导致这个错误的语句如下: dtPriceTable.Rows.InsertAt(aDataRow,i); 或者 dtPriceTable.Rows.Add(aDataRow); 我分析了一下原因,因为DataRow DataTable 都是传引用调用的 阅读全文

posted @ 2016-09-30 10:41 _ali 阅读(6410) 评论(0) 推荐(0) 编辑

2016年9月29日

fastreport.net cdoe 自己的代码

摘要: //初始 Report report1 = new Report(); report1.Clear(); string ReportFileName = GetReportFileName(Rep); //report1.Load(Environment.CurrentDirectory + "\\ 阅读全文

posted @ 2016-09-29 09:36 _ali 阅读(956) 评论(0) 推荐(0) 编辑

动态创建Fastreport(delphi)

摘要: 动态创建Fastreport分以下几个步骤: 1.首先清空Fastreport,定义全局变量,并加载数据集 frReport.Clear; frReport.DataSets.Add(frxDBDataset1); DataHeight :=28; DataWidth :=80; FirstTop 阅读全文

posted @ 2016-09-29 09:35 _ali 阅读(1365) 评论(0) 推荐(0) 编辑

导航